Sinner, here’s the situation to become number one in the World

After Rome there will be only one week’s break and then all or most of the athletes will move to France for one of the four Slams scheduled each year. But this, calculations in hand, could not preclude him as mentioned from being the first in the space of a very short time.


“For this hypothesis to occur, it is necessary that Djokovic and Medvedev, at the conclusion of Paris, have a dowry of Atp points less than 8725. In order for this circumstance to occur it is necessary that Djokovic in Paris does not go further than the semifinals (800 Atp points) and in Rome does not reach the quarterfinals (200 points). With these 1,000 points Djokovic would bring himself to 8710 points and thus 15 points below Sinner.” Difficult, this situation, Djokovic, at least in Rome, is the number one favorite given also the absences. And then there would also have to be another condition. “Medvedev, on the other hand, would remain behind Sinner even by winning Rome again and then reaching the final at Roland Garros (8145 points). Or by winning Paris and making semifinals in Rome (8595). Alcaraz and co. on the other hand will have to wait much longer. “
